Education Service Center (ESC), Region 20's Career and Technical Education (CTE) services are designed to assist districts in promoting the development and implementation of rigorous and challenging CTE programs. Through collaboration and support, ESC-20 is available to assist districts with the following:

  • Implement career guidance programs for grades 7-12
  • Implement appropriate curriculum for CTE programs
  • Integrate academic and CTE programs
  • Preparation for the CTE Compliance visit
  • Integrate academic and CTE programs
  • Implement work-based learning and apprenticeship programs
  • Integrate academic and CTE programs
  • Complete the Carl Perkins annual application for federal and state funds
  • Promote nontraditional educational activities
  • Eliminate gender bias
  • Develop appropriate and timely staff development opportunities for CTE personnel
  • Promote Tech-Prep and High Schools that Work initiatives
  • Prepare for Office of Civil Rights (OCR) visit
  • Provide customized services and support
